Bryce Canyon Hoodoos at Fairyland Point | Utah Panorama
A panoramic landscape photograph shows closely packed orange and tan hoodoos rising from a deeply eroded canyon at Fairyland Point in Bryce Canyon National Park. Warm low-angle light highlights the layered rock spires, while evergreen trees and shaded canyon recesses create strong contrast. Captured in autumn on the Fairyland Loop Trail in southern Utah.
10.10.2010 · Fairyland Loop Trail, Garfield County, Utah, United States
